I've installed XBMC 10.1 (Dharma) using the PPA package under Ubuntu 10.10.
If I want to test out the PVR branch, I know I need to compile it (which isn't a problem) but how can I run the stable release (from the PPA package) alongside the PVR release?
Is this possible?
